Formal Pronunciation

When it comes to formal pronunciation, it’s important to emphasize clarity and enunciation.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of how to say “Baluchistan pygmy jerboa” in a formal setting:

  1. Start with the word “Baluchistan.” Pronounce it as “bah-loo-chis-tahn”. Make sure to clearly enunciate each syllable.
  2. Then, move on to “pygmy.” Say it as “pig-mee” with a short and crisp “i” sound.
  3. Finally, pronounce “jerboa” as “jer-boh-uh.” Stress the first syllable, and let the “uh” sound at the end be subtle.
